Direct (nonstop) flights from Birmingham to Hurghada
2 airlines fly nonstop from Birmingham Airport (BHX) to Hurghada International Airport (HRG). It's 2,526 miles (4,066 km), about 5h 20m in the air. Operated by Jet2, easyJet.

How far is Birmingham from Hurghada?
The flight distance from Birmingham to Hurghada is 2,526 miles (4,066 km), measured as the great-circle (shortest air) distance. That's roughly the same distance as New York to Los Angeles.
What is the time difference between Birmingham and Hurghada?
Hurghada is 2 hours ahead of Birmingham. (Europe/London vs Africa/Cairo.)
